Vishay manufactures one of the world's largest portfolios of discrete semiconductors and passive electronic components that are essential to innovative designs in the automotive, industrial, computing, consumer, telecommunications, military, aerospace, and medical markets. Do you want to help us build the DNA of tech.?  We are seeking a world-class R&D Engineer to lead innovation in advanced MOSFET technologies. This role will drive next-generation device architecture, performance optimization, and technology strategy across our power and/or logic semiconductor portfolio.

 This position is based in the Greater Phoenix Area, Arizona.

What you will be doing:

MOSFET Device & Technology Development

  • Develop and optimize advanced power MOSFET device structures and technologies to achieve electrical, reliability, cost, and manufacturability requirements
  • Design new products to meet cost, performance, reliability, and manufacturing requirements.
  • Apply semiconductor device physics to analyze and optimize key performance parameters and efficiency in target applications
  • Originate and evaluate new device concepts, materials, structures, and process technologies to deliver best in class performance
  • Perform technology benchmarking and competitive analysis of semiconductor devices and processes
  • Contribute to technology roadmaps and long-term semiconductor R&D strategies.

Required Qualifications

  • Master's degree in Electrical Engineering, Electrical & Computer Engineering, Materials Science, Physics, Chemical Engineering, or a related technical field.
  • Ph.D. preferred in Electrical Engineering, Semiconductor Engineering, Materials Science, or Physics.
  • 3+ years of semiconductor industry experience in MOSFET, power semiconductor, discrete semiconductor, or related device/process development.
  • Strong understanding of MOSFET device physics and semiconductor processing.
  • Experience with bench test, device characterization, and electrical test data analysis.
  • Experience with semiconductor fabrication processes and wafer manufacturing.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and experimental design skills.
  • Ability to work effectively across multidisciplinary engineering and manufacturing organizations.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ience developing power MOSFETs, including planar, trench, superjunction, or other advanced MOSFET architectures.
  • Experience with high-voltage and/or low-voltage power semiconductor technologies.
  • Experience with semiconductor device simulation and modeling tools such as TCAD.
  • Experience with process and device simulation, DOE, statistical analysis, and process capability analysis.
  • Familiarity with semiconductor reliability physics and qualification methodologies.
  • Experience with wafer fabrication and semiconductor process integration.
  • Experience with semiconductor failure analysis methods and tools and root-cause methodologies.
  • Programming or data-analysis experience using Python, MATLAB, JMP, Minitab, or similar tools.
  • Experience taking semiconductor technology from concept through qualification, volume ramp, and new product release.
  • Knowledge of power MOSFET applications

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
